WHAT WE TEACH

Successful rowers develop a deep practical understanding of the power of teamwork. They learn to build and perform as a team, and they learn to deal with the common obstacles and snags that impede teamwork. Rowers learn a kind of mental discipline that serves them well in any endeavor they may undertake.

THE GREAT SPORT OF ROWING

Rowing has been described as the "ultimate team sport" because each rower's individual effort, no matter how great, must harmonize with that of every other rower to create the smooth, synchronous flow of a winning boat.

  • USRowing Relevant Adult Participants are required to take the 90-minute SafeSport Trained course.

    30-minute Refresher courses are available as parts of this series after the initial training has been completed.

    Any member who is not defined as a Relevant Adult Participant, is not required to complete any form of SafeSport training.
